This list highlights some of the best films from the visionary Joe Dante, a director known for his sharp wit, love of classic monster movies, and uncanny ability to blend comedy, horror, and science fiction. From creature features that redefined the genre to satires that skewered American life, Dante's filmography is a treasure trove of imaginative storytelling and visual flair. Now it's your turn! While not a traditional movie, *Polybius* earns its place on the "Best Joe Dante Movies" list as a prime example of his subversive wit and mastery of urban legends. This short film, part of the *Masters of Horror* anthology series, plunges headfirst into the infamous tale of a government-controlled arcade game rumored to cause psychological distress and brainwashing. Dante expertly utilizes the format to explore themes of paranoia, government conspiracy, and the addictive nature of technology, all hallmarks of his best work. He manages to create a chilling atmosphere with limited resources, building suspense through flickering lights, ominous sound design, and unsettling visuals, effectively capturing the essence of the original legend's mystique. Furthermore, *Polybius* showcases Dante's playful cynicism towards authority figures and his willingness to challenge conventional narratives. He doesn't shy away from the absurdity of the situation, injecting subtle humor that both entertains and unsettles. The film's ending, intentionally ambiguous, leaves the viewer questioning the reality they perceive, a characteristic often found in Dante's more satirical and thought-provoking features like *Gremlins 2: The New Batch*. It's a concise and effective piece of filmmaking that demonstrates his talent for taking fantastical concepts and grounding them in a relatable fear of manipulation, making it a worthy addition to any collection of his best works.
